To provide binary packages we first have to solve the problem
with the hardcoded paths (data-dir, locale-dir, font-path),
because we can't force users to install it at a specific location.

What do you think about configuring the paths via XML?
I don't know exactly how flexible autopackage is, but perhaps it
is able to write the xml-config during installation so that the paths are
configured correctly.
